Which Are Registered Agent Solutions?

Registered agent services play a key role for companies, especially those operating in the U.S.. A registered agent acts as the designated point of communication for a business, collecting essential legal documents and state correspondence on behalf of the business. This encompasses service of process, tax forms, and official state communications. By appointing a registered agent, companies guarantee they remain compliant with state regulations and maintaining a level of privacy for their owners.

These solutions are particularly valuable for businesses that may not have a physical location in the state where they are registered. Having a registered agent enables these companies to function remotely and still fulfilling legal obligations. Furthermore, registered agents are commonly available during regular business hours, guaranteeing that critical documents are received promptly and processed appropriately. This can reduce the risk of overlooking critical deadlines and facing penalties.

In addition to compliance and privacy, registered agent services can help organizations oversee their administrative tasks more efficiently. By outsourcing this function, businesses can focus on their core operations rather than being distracted by paperwork and notifications. Overall, registered agent services are a functional solution for new businesses and established companies alike, aiding in the smooth functioning of their operations across various jurisdictions.

Cost Considerations

When evaluating registered agent services in the USA, it is crucial to assess the related expenses. Such services typically charge an annual fee, that can range widely based on the provider and the services offered. Standard plans may begin at $50 per year, while advanced packages that offer extra benefits like compliance monitoring and mail forwarding can exceed $300 per year. It's crucial to contrast various companies to understand what each package includes and make sure you receive the optimal value for your requirements.
